SAN FRANCISCO–(BUSINESS WIRE)–The Itanium® Solutions Alliance today announced the launch of the second Itanium Solutions Alliance Innovation Award. The annual program recognizes unique and innovative deployments of Itanium® 2-based solutions from all areas of computing and research. The judging panel for the Itanium Solutions Alliance Innovation Award is comprised of 11 industry experts and analysts.

End users and developers of Itanium-based applications can enter their solution in one of three areas to be considered for each category’s $50,000 cash prize. Contest entries are due February 29, 2008 with category winners announced later in the spring. The award categories are:

  • Humanitarian Impact: The Humanitarian Impact category awards the innovative use of applications running on Itanium-based systems where these systems demonstrate an impact on humanity through research, social improvements or other humanitarian efforts. Examples include weather prediction, storm monitoring, tsunami model forecasting, and genetic and medical research.
  • Enterprise Business Application: The Enterprise Business category awards the creative use of applications utilizing the benefits of the Intel® Itanium® architecture to produce either hard business results (such as cost savings and ROI) or soft business impact (including customer satisfaction and new product development).
  • Entrepreneurial Innovation: This award is open to all entities excluding public companies with revenues exceeding US $25 million in the last reporting period. The award recognizes enhanced business operations using applications that take full advantage of the Intel Itanium architecture and rewards achievements in areas such as IT consolidation, increased ROI or customer satisfaction, and new product development.
